arcgis新建数据库文件名无效

arcgis新建数据库文件名无效,第1张

1、Arcgis无法连接数据/数据库连接或创建失败解决方法

最近好多同事在使用arcgis过程中出现无法连接数据库或者是无法创建数据库。连接到数据库失败;无法创建新的数据库,权限被拒绝(如下图)。

出现这个原因是你所用的电脑系统文件dao360dll损坏或缺失。

解决办法:首先检查一下电脑系统文件夹,文件夹位置:C:\Program Files (x86)\Common Files\Microsoft Shared\dao,如果没有DAO文件夹或有DAO文件夹却没有dao360dll则下载一个dao360dll文件或者从其他电脑复制一个到相应的路径下即可解决(没有DAO文件夹的先自己新建一个文件夹命名为DAO)。

2、点击add data,不显示链接过的文件夹,显示空白

1)删除地图模板,默认模板

Win7路径:C:\Users\当前登录用户名\AppData\Roaming\ESRI\Desktop10X\ArcMap\Templates\Normalmxt

Win10路径:C:\Users\当前登录用户名\Desktop10X\AppData\Roaming\ESRI\ArcMap\Templates\Normalmxt

2)点击运行,输入regedit,选择HKEY_CURRENT_USER\Software\ESRI,重命名ESRI为ESRI_1

3、栅格计算器里表达式输入框不见/找不到

解决方法:按住Ctrl+鼠标滚轮

4、shapefile数据属性表乱码或导出后在excel打开乱码

一般遇到这种问题有两个原因,其一是excel显示语言设置有问题,其二就是arcgis软件的问题。

1)excel显示语言设置

打开Excel——文件——选项——语言,看看编辑语言。

选择中文,点击“设为默认值”,设定完成后重启一下Excel

2)arcgis相关设置

原因:Shp文件的头文件中,一般会包含shp文件使用的编码类型信息,这个信息称为LDID(Language Driver ID),这样在使用应用程序打开shp的时候,应用程序就会自动判别用何种编码类型去正确读取它,而不会发生乱码。利用ArcGIS Desktop生产的shp数据中通常会包含这项信息。在Shp文件的子文件中,有时我们还会发现同名的cpg文件,cpg文件中也存储了编码信息,用记事本打开,可以看到(例如utf-8)。

以上二者被ArcGIS识别的优先顺序是,LDID优先于CPG文件。也就是如果头文件中没有约定读shapefile的编码类型时,如果这时刚好有个CPG文件,那么ArcGIS就会使用这里的编码类型读取。

但shapefile 是个开放格式,只要你了解了数据规范,完全可以脱离ArcGIS自己生产出来。在Windows中文语言设置下,假设你自己写代码或者使用第三方的程序生产了shapefile,例如MapGIS,默认使用CP936(GBK)编码存储,但是无论粗心大意还是有意为之没有在数据头文件中约定“我用了936!”。如果是ArcGIS 102和之前的版本,那么没问题,ArcGIS默认就是以这种方式识别,没有乱码。可是拿到ArcGIS 1021,ArcGIS 1022,ArcGIS 103x 这几个版本中发现乱码了!因为在缺失LDID和CPG时,这几个版本默认使用UTF-8来读取shapefile,这样必然乱码了。

第一步,启动arccatalog,连接数据库

第二步,创建一个dataset

第三步,选择dataset,然后点击鼠标右键,选择导入——要素类(单个),将第一幅cad图形数据导入数据库并产生一个Feature Layer

第四步,选择刚刚新产生的Feature Layer,然后点击鼠标右键,在d出的快捷菜单中选择加载(Load)——加载数据(Load Data)

第五步,根据加载数据向导进行数据添加。

依次完成后,系统自动完成数据地拼接。

arcgis 支持3种数据库平台,sql server ,PostgreSQL和oracle,在arcmap界面下的toolbox工具-》数据管理工具-》地理数据库管理-》创建企业级地理数据库 ,然后填写数据库用户密码等其他选项即可

可能是软件出错了。建议重新下载安装看看,

安装教程

1、首先先下载ArcGIS v102中文破解版安装包,解压出来后有“iso文件”,可以用虚拟光驱启动,如果没有的话就是用压缩工具进行解压。

2、解压之后选择里面“ESRLexe”进行运行。

3、点击图中小编框起来的“setup”。

4、勾选我接受协议,勾选之后,点击“next”。

5、选择安装的路径,更根据实际情况来决定,建议还是根据默认来。

6、接下来就是简单的下一步下一步,这里就不仔细说,相信你们会的,知道安装至完成。

7、安装完成之后,ArcGIS v102中文破解版就会自动启动License Manager,直接选择停止服务“stop”。(建议关闭,然后重新打开,这样 *** 作之后会将界面变成中文)

8、然后在进行安装ArcGIS Desktop。

9、因为 *** 作都一样这里就不仔细详解了,一直点击下一步就OK了。

10、安装完成之后还d出窗口全是英文,点击OK就好,与上述 *** 作一样ArcGIS会自动启动ArcGIS v102中文破解版,(建议关闭后重新打开,这样界面会变中文)将其中的名称改为localhost。

ArcGIS :>

步骤:

1、在文件夹连接找到你数据库的位置

2、右键点击数据库,选择导入要素类(单个)

输入要素就选择shp文件,输出位置不用改,输出要素类取一个名字即可,确定完成

以上就是关于arcgis新建数据库文件名无效全部的内容,包括:arcgis新建数据库文件名无效、arcgis数据处理,如何进行数据拼接、arcgis10.2怎么连接9.2空间数据库等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址:https://54852.com/sjk/9769886.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-05-01
下一篇2023-05-01

发表评论

登录后才能评论

评论列表(0条)

    保存